Review: Empire Baking Co.

|

Sure, you know all about chocolate bunnies and eggs. But Easter also boasts the hot cross bun. Studded with dried fruit and spiced with cinnamon, cloves, or cardamom, this bun is a thing of beauty, a nifty round with its cross formed by stark white icing. Like most seasonal breads, this one has religious roots, originating with the pagans until the Christians converted them. In England, everyone eats these buns for breakfast on Good Friday. Empire Baking Co. goes deluxe with theirs, adding cranberries, apricots, and a sleek, glossy top. Don’t delay: by Easter Sunday, they’ll be gone.
